What Is The Story About?

While it is unclear as to which arc the anime will adapt from the source material, we do know that the origin story of Shinpei will be a part of the anime. The story of Summer Time Rendering takes us to Wakayama Island on Hotogashima island, where Shinpei is returning after a long time. He is back in his hometown to mourn the passing away of a close family relative. However, he never expected his reunion with his hometown in such a way.

The mysteries that lurk beneath the surface of his island are untying all the strings that he left behind ages ago. What is Shinpei stepping into?
